Strategies to Handle Language Barriers When Interacting with Tourists from Different Countries:

  1. Utilize Translation Apps: Leverage technology to overcome language barriers instantly. Utilize mobile apps like Google Translate or iTranslate to quickly translate conversations, signs, and menus.

  2. Seek Language Assistance: Partner with local businesses, language schools, or cultural organizations to provide language interpreters or translators during tours, workshops, or special events.

  3. Hire Multilingual Staff: Recruit tour guides, customer service representatives, and hotel staff who are proficient in multiple languages. This ensures seamless communication throughout the tourist’s experience.

  4. Provide Visual Support: Use images, maps, infographics, and clear signage to convey information visually. Visuals can transcend language barriers and enhance comprehension.
